Output 51f109dcdfb7e6ddb77f451fa3badb4b79bb18d26021d27cac9d0610eac85825:40

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bd4c06bf2f09208f129dd9884b83362a905662b OP_EQUAL
address
32maDu1PZ4SwK98RTYFhTQM2U6w92rxqov
transaction
51f109dcdfb7e6ddb77f451fa3badb4b79bb18d26021d27cac9d0610eac85825
spent
true